IMPORTANT: The sensor in your dishwasher monitors the soil level. Cycle time and/or water usage can vary as the sensor adjusts the
cycle for the best wash performance. If the incoming water is less than the recommended temperature or food soils are heavy, the cycle
will automatically compensate by adding time, heat and water as needed.

Raises the water temperature in the final rinse to
approximately 155°F (68°C). This high temperature rinse
sanitizes your dishes and glassware in accordance with
NSF/ANSI Standard 184 for Residential Dishwashers.
Certified residential dishwashers are not intended for
licensed food establishments.
The Sanitize or Sani Rinse option adds heat and time to the
cycle.

To turn on Lock, press and hold ProDry for at least
3 seconds.
To turn off Lock, press and hold ProDry for at least
3 seconds.
When Control Lock is lit, all buttons are disabled. If you press
any pad while your dishwasher is locked, the light flashes
3 times. The dishwasher drawer can be opened while the
controls are locked.

If the drawer is opened during a cycle, a delay, or the power is interrupted, the Start/Resume
indicator flashes. To restart the drawer, open the drawer, press Start/Resume and close the
drawer firmly within 4 seconds./
Close the drawer firmly. The dishwasher starts a 2-minute drain (if needed). Let the dishwasher
drain completely. If the Cancel button is pressed a second time, the drawer will turn off.
Clean indicator glows when a cycle is finished.
If you select the Sani Rinse option, when the Sani Rinse cycle is finished, the Sanitized indicator
glows. If your dishwasher did not properly sanitize your dishes, the light flashes at the end of the
cycle. This can happen if the cycle is interrupted, or the water could not be heated to the required
temperature. The light goes off when you open and close the drawer or press CANCEL.
The rinse aid low indicator light glows when the rinse aid dispenser needs to be refilled.
